SQL2012字符串日期转换失败排查指南

创始人
2024-12-28 05:47:41
0 次浏览
0 评论

求助:sql2012中从字符串转换日期和/或时间时,转换失败。

检查两个设备的时间和日期格式设置是否相同。
一般是24小时制,不带汉字。
如果中文格式不正确,文本可能无法转换为日期数据

从字符串转换日期和/或时间时,转换失败

格式错误、时区问题、闰秒问题等。
1.格式错误:输入的日期或时间的格式必须符合特定的标准格式,否则转换将失败。
例如,在Java中,日期格式为yyyy-MM-ddHH:mm:ss,输入的日期格式不符合这个标准,转换就会失败。
解决方案是检查输入的日期格式是否正确,并尝试使用适当的格式化库或工具将日期格式化为正确的格式。
2.时区问题:计算日期和时间导致时区问题,如果输入的日期和时间没有指定时区或者指定的时区不正确,则会导致转换失败。
解决方案是在转换之前指定正确的时区,并确保您输入的日期和时间包含正确的时区信息。
3、闰秒问题:计算机内部处理时间时,有时会遇到闰秒问题,即由于地球自转速度的变化,导致计算机内部时钟与实际时间存在偏差。
此偏差会导致日期和时间转换失败。
解决方案是在转换之前考虑闰秒,并使用适当的时间库或工具来处理闰秒。

从字符串转换日期和/或时间时,转换失败。源错误:

在SQL字符串后插入显示语句,显示字符串值并检查是否符合SQL语法。
它可能不符合SQL语法。
热门文章
1
Python代码实现:如何判断三角形的三... python三角形三条边长,判断能否构成三角形Python三角形的三个长边如下:...

2
高效掌握:CMD命令轻松启动、关闭及登录... 如何用cmd命令快速启动和关闭mysql数据库服务开发中经常使用MySQL数据库...

3
SQL字段默认值设置全攻略:轻松实现自动... sql如何设置字段默认值设置SQL中某个字段的默认值;需要遵循几个步骤。首先您需...

4
MySQL查询加速秘籍:PolarDB ... mysql中in大量数据导致查询速度慢怎么优化?在MySQL中处理大量数据时,查...

5
SQL2000数据库备份压缩技巧:优化空... 怎么将SQL2000中的较大的备份数据库压缩变小更改数据库属性-选项-恢复模型很...

6
SQL字符串处理技巧:单引号使用与转义标... SQL语句中,字符串类型的值均使用什么符号标明?单引号如果字符串内有单引号,请小...

7
Windows环境下Redis安装指南与... redis安装windowsredis基本简介与安装安装Redis首先需要获取安...

8
深度解析:Redis性能优势与局限性,助... redis有哪些优缺点?Redis的全称是RemoteDictionary.Se...

9
深入解析:MySQL数据库的特性与应用 mysql是什么MySQL是一个关系数据库管理系统。MySQL是一个开源关系数据...

10
MySQL自增主键重置攻略:解决用尽问题... MySQL让有数据的表主键从1开始连续自增当您需要MySQL中的数据表使用连续数...